Home
last modified time | relevance | path

Searched refs:channel_lock (Results 1 - 12 of 12) sorted by relevance

/kernel/linux/linux-5.10/net/rxrpc/
H A Dconn_client.c129 spin_lock_init(&bundle->channel_lock); in rxrpc_alloc_bundle()
392 spin_lock(&bundle->channel_lock); in rxrpc_prep_call()
394 spin_unlock(&bundle->channel_lock); in rxrpc_prep_call()
408 __releases(bundle->channel_lock)
419 spin_unlock(&bundle->channel_lock);
427 spin_lock(&bundle->channel_lock);
432 spin_unlock(&bundle->channel_lock);
459 spin_unlock(&bundle->channel_lock);
482 spin_lock(&bundle->channel_lock); in rxrpc_maybe_add_conn()
506 spin_unlock(&bundle->channel_lock); in rxrpc_maybe_add_conn()
[all...]
H A Dconn_event.c168 spin_lock(&conn->bundle->channel_lock); in rxrpc_abort_calls()
173 lockdep_is_held(&conn->bundle->channel_lock)); in rxrpc_abort_calls()
190 spin_unlock(&conn->bundle->channel_lock); in rxrpc_abort_calls()
352 spin_lock(&conn->bundle->channel_lock); in rxrpc_process_event()
362 lockdep_is_held(&conn->bundle->channel_lock))); in rxrpc_process_event()
367 spin_unlock(&conn->bundle->channel_lock); in rxrpc_process_event()
H A Dconn_service.c14 .channel_lock = __SPIN_LOCK_UNLOCKED(&rxrpc_service_dummy_bundle.channel_lock),
H A Dconn_object.c161 * terminates. The caller must hold the channel_lock and must release the
222 spin_lock(&conn->bundle->channel_lock); in rxrpc_disconnect_call()
224 spin_unlock(&conn->bundle->channel_lock); in rxrpc_disconnect_call()
H A Drxkad.c1172 spin_lock(&conn->bundle->channel_lock); in rxkad_verify_response()
1189 lockdep_is_held(&conn->bundle->channel_lock)); in rxkad_verify_response()
1195 spin_unlock(&conn->bundle->channel_lock); in rxkad_verify_response()
1222 spin_unlock(&conn->bundle->channel_lock); in rxkad_verify_response()
H A Dar-internal.h392 spinlock_t channel_lock; member
/kernel/linux/linux-5.10/drivers/most/
H A Dmost_usb.c94 * @channel_lock: synchronize channel access
112 spinlock_t channel_lock[MAX_NUM_ENDPOINTS]; /* sync channel access */ member
247 lock = mdev->channel_lock + channel; in hdm_poison_channel()
345 spinlock_t *lock = mdev->channel_lock + channel; in hdm_write_completion()
398 spinlock_t *lock = mdev->channel_lock + channel; in hdm_read_completion()
1041 spin_lock_init(&mdev->channel_lock[i]); in hdm_probe()
/kernel/linux/linux-5.10/drivers/gpu/ipu-v3/
H A Dipu-common.c209 mutex_lock(&ipu->channel_lock); in ipu_idmac_get()
229 mutex_unlock(&ipu->channel_lock); in ipu_idmac_get()
241 mutex_lock(&ipu->channel_lock); in ipu_idmac_put()
246 mutex_unlock(&ipu->channel_lock); in ipu_idmac_put()
1354 mutex_init(&ipu->channel_lock); in ipu_probe()
H A Dipu-prv.h174 struct mutex channel_lock; member
/kernel/linux/linux-6.6/drivers/most/
H A Dmost_usb.c94 * @channel_lock: synchronize channel access
112 spinlock_t channel_lock[MAX_NUM_ENDPOINTS]; /* sync channel access */ member
247 lock = mdev->channel_lock + channel; in hdm_poison_channel()
345 spinlock_t *lock = mdev->channel_lock + channel; in hdm_write_completion()
398 spinlock_t *lock = mdev->channel_lock + channel; in hdm_read_completion()
1041 spin_lock_init(&mdev->channel_lock[i]); in hdm_probe()
/kernel/linux/linux-6.6/drivers/gpu/ipu-v3/
H A Dipu-common.c209 mutex_lock(&ipu->channel_lock); in ipu_idmac_get()
229 mutex_unlock(&ipu->channel_lock); in ipu_idmac_get()
241 mutex_lock(&ipu->channel_lock); in ipu_idmac_put()
246 mutex_unlock(&ipu->channel_lock); in ipu_idmac_put()
1351 mutex_init(&ipu->channel_lock); in ipu_probe()
H A Dipu-prv.h175 struct mutex channel_lock; member

Completed in 16 milliseconds